Engine Specifications
Outfitted with a durable style, the VQ35 engine in the Nissan Murano supplies a mix of power and efficiency that improves the SUV's efficiency. This 3.5-liter V6 engine is crafted with a light weight aluminum alloy block and aluminum DOHC (Double Overhead Web cam) cyndrical tube heads, adding to its lightweight characteristics while making sure toughness. The VQ35 engine supplies a maximum result of about 245 horse power at 6,000 RPM and a torque ranking of around 246 lb-ft at 4,400 RPM, facilitating solid velocity and responsiveness.
Including sophisticated modern technologies, the VQ35 includes continual variable valve timing (CVVT) on both the consumption and exhaust sides. This advancement enhances engine performance throughout different RPM ranges, enhancing both power distribution and gas performance. Furthermore, the engine utilizes a multi-port fuel injection system, making sure specific gas atomization for boosted combustion.
The VQ35 is mated to a continually variable transmission (CVT), which supplies seamless equipment shifts and improves driving convenience. On the whole, the requirements of the VQ35 engine exhibit Nissan's commitment to efficiency and dependability, making it a beneficial attribute for the Murano SUV.

Dependability and Upkeep
Integrity is a critical consideration for SUV proprietors, and the VQ35 engine in the Nissan Murano shows a solid performance history in this regard. This engine, known for its durable construction and engineering quality, has gathered beneficial reviews from both customers and automobile professionals alike. With a design that emphasizes longevity, the VQ35 has revealed durability versus usual wear and tear, adding to its reputation as a trustworthy powertrain.
Routine upkeep is necessary to make certain the longevity of the VQ35 engine. Normal oil modifications, commonly recommended every 5,000 to 7,500 miles, are important for maintaining optimum performance and avoiding engine wear. Furthermore, monitoring coolant levels and replacing the timing belt at the defined periods can substantially boost the engine's reliability.
While the VQ35 has fewer reported problems compared to some competitors, it is not immune to potential difficulties, such as oil leakages or sensing unit failings. Proactive upkeep and attending to small concerns immediately can minimize these worries (vq35). In general, the VQ35 engine stands out as a dependable option for SUV enthusiasts seeking performance and satisfaction in their car
